From the Food Network site:

Episode 404

Chef Dale Talde brings a chip on his shoulder and challenging round three ingredients in hopes of stumping the Titans to win $25,000. Bobby Flay invites royalty to judge the competition, and "Queen" Giada De Laurentiis expects excellence.

From the FN site:

Season 4, Episode 5

Titans vs Michelle Wallace

Top Chef Fan Favorite winner Chef Michelle Wallace feels like the underdog against Bobby Flay's Titans, but she's here to prove her down-home Southern flavors can compete with anyone to win $25,000. Katie Lee Biegel, star of The Kitchen, determines the winner.

From the Food Network site:

Episode 407

Chef Martel Stone infuses his laid-back sensibilities and West African-inspired flavors into Bobby Flay's Triple Threat club. The Titans know better than to underestimate Martel's cool vibe, as he is here to settle a score with Brooke Williamson. Global chef Lorna Maseko judges.

Well it begins tonight with the new Titan. Here is the FN description:

Episode 401

A new season brings with it a brand-new Titan, Ayesha Nurdjaja. Bobby Flay isn't taking it easy on this new Titan however, as he invites the winner of Last Bite Hotel, Chef Nini Nguyen, to challenge the Titans. Judge Daniel Boulud keeps the pressure high with his legendary palate.
